I have a 74 body that I'm working on putting on my 78 frame. I really like the look of the ambulance doors when the hard top is on, but I like the look of the barn doors when the hard top is off. I have seen the build threads for the rear ambulance half door modification, but all I have seen for the lower tub is the drop-down tailgate with this combo. I would rather stick with barn doors rather than a tailgate. Does anyone have any examples of the upper half ambulance doors with the lower barn doors? Thoughts?
 
I was actually having this exact same thought the other day. Since mine is a 72, which was (poorly) converted to ambulance doors, I'd like to reinstall barn doors, but also have the ambulance doors when the top is on. My idea consists of having the lower ambulance door hinge be the top barn door hinge, and when the barn doors are not on just capping the lower barn door hinge mounting holes with screws or plastic inserts.
